Of Counsel for Trial, Appellate, and Litigation

Stephani is responsible for representing clients across industries in the agency tribunals at the Department of Labor, Department of Energy, and Merit Systems Protection Board. She also represents clients in state and federal jury and bench trials and appellate courts across the United States.

Stephani graduated cum laude from Harvard University with a degree in Environmental Science and Public Policy. She obtained her Juris Doctorate from The George Washington University School of Law. She joined Government Accountability Project as a Litigation Attorney in 2002 where she represented whistleblowers in the nuclear and oil industries and federal government employees. In 2005, Stephani Ayers and Government Accountability Project’s Litigation Director at the time, Thad Guyer, founded the firm of T.M. Guyer and Ayers & Friends, PC. Ayers expanded her practice in 2005 to include whistleblowers in the airline, food, pharmaceutical, and financial industries.
